About the Program

The medicinal and economic botany certificate is designed for students with an interest in the practical uses of plants, both known and yet to be discovered. The program requires a basic knowledge of biology and chemistry, but is available to students in a variety of majors, such as anthropology, conservation biology, or environmental education.

The program emphasizes historical and cultural botany, modern medicinal plants, and practical plant production and concludes with research or field experience.
